One highly recommended gluten-free restaurant in Toronto is "Kupfert & Kim." This eatery is a vegan and gluten-free restaurant that offers a wide range of options on its menu. It is popular among locals and tourists alike and is known for its delicious dishes such as the quinoa bowls, which are a must-try.

Another great option for gluten-free cuisine in Toronto is "Impact Kitchen." This restaurant offers an extensive menu of healthy, gluten-free options, including salads, bowls, and sandwiches. The restaurant prides itself on using fresh ingredients and locally sourced produce.

If you're looking for Michelin-starred gluten-free restaurants in Toronto, unfortunately, there are none at this time. However, several highly acclaimed restaurants have a reputation for catering to gluten-free diners. These include Canoe, Alo Restaurant, and Grey Gardens.

Price-wise, gluten-free dining in Toronto can be expensive depending on where you go. However, many affordable options are available as well. For instance, Kupfert & Kim's average price per dish ranges from $10-$15, while Impact Kitchen's average price per dish ranges from $13-$17.
